Output d6654303a4882f1ee29496fc63107e072be0cdf17daf7960a459863c4c003788:2

value
409627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38fe4a52b9500b14fa0a32f66eb302acf637e4f OP_EQUAL
address
3KX44pcSHfhbfaGDUn858SBjTMQTP1TWpM
transaction
d6654303a4882f1ee29496fc63107e072be0cdf17daf7960a459863c4c003788
spent
true